Ethernet fiber cables, also known as fiber optic cables, transmit data using light signals instead of electrical pulses. This technology allows for faster data transfer rates and greater distances without signal degradation. Fiber optic cables are made up of thin strands of glass or plastic that carry light signals, making them resistant to electromagnetic interference (EMI) and capable of supporting high bandwidth applications.
